Beijing to Berlin

9h 34m The flight from Beijing Capital International Airport (PEK) to Berlin Brandenburg Airport (BER) covers 7,358 km (4,572 miles) and takes approximately 9h 34m gate to gate for a typical jet.

The route heads north-west on an initial great-circle bearing of 319°, passing near 59.0° N, 73.1° E at its midpoint.

Flight time at different cruise speeds

Aircraft type, winds and routing all move the real number. This is the same distance flown at different speeds, plus the 25-minute ground and climb allowance.

Typical ofCruise speedAirborneGate to gate
Turboprop / regional550 km/h13h 23m13h 48m
Narrowbody jet (A320, 737)780 km/h9h 26m9h 51m
Widebody jet (777, 787, A350)900 km/h8h 11m8h 36m
Private jet (Gulfstream)850 km/h8h 39m9h 05m

Headwinds on an eastbound long-haul routinely add 30–60 minutes; the same route westbound can be quicker. Airlines publish schedules with padding built in.

How far is Beijing from Berlin?

7,358 kilometres in a straight line over the earth's surface — 4,572 miles or 3,973 nautical miles. Actual flown distance is usually 2–5% longer because aircraft follow airways, avoid weather and route around restricted airspace.
